WebView2 最终用户常见问题解答

您所在的位置:网站首页 chrome安装后找不到 WebView2 最终用户常见问题解答

WebView2 最终用户常见问题解答

2023-04-10 07:33| 来源: 网络整理| 查看: 265

WebView2 最终用户常见问题解答 项目 04/06/2023

此常见问题解答 (常见问题解答) 页面向最终用户,用于解释任务管理器中列出的 WebView2 或 msedgewebview2.exe 进程。 另请参阅 联系 WebView2 团队。

什么是 WebView2?

WebView2 是应用开发人员在 Windows 应用程序中嵌入 Web 内容 ((如 HTML、JavaScript 和 CSS) )的一种方式。 通过将 WebView2 控件包含在应用中,开发人员可以为网站或 Web 应用编写代码,然后在其 Windows 应用程序中重复使用该 Web 代码,从而节省时间和精力。 请参阅 Microsoft Edge WebView2 简介。

WebView2 可执行文件的用途是什么?

WebView2 (msedgewebview2.exe) 是一种 Microsoft 产品,它通过使用 Evergreen 分发方法) 自动更新 (,以确保应用程序具有最新的功能支持和安全修补程序。

大多数人将看到小组件、Teams、Office、Outlook、天气等应用程序使用的 WebView2。 任何应用程序都可以使用 WebView2。

正在运行的 WebView2 进程有哪些?

WebView2 遵循在 Microsoft Edge 的 Chromium 浏览器引擎中使用的进程模型,如进程模型和站点隔离中所述。 将功能分解为多个进程有助于提高可靠性、安全性和性能。 每个进程都执行特定的责任,并且即使其他一个进程遇到问题,也能不间断地完成该工作。

通常有几个进程:

WebView2 管理器。 GPU 进程。 实用工具进程,例如网络或音频,具体取决于内容。 呈现器进程。

对于使用 WebView2 的每个应用,计算机将有一组进程,并且通常为应用中的每个 WebView2 控件提供一个呈现器进程,类似于在浏览器中每个选项卡都有一个呈现器进程。 有关详细信息,请参阅 WebView2 应用的进程模型。

WebView2 使用哪些内存和 CPU 资源?

在大多数情况下,任何额外的内存或 CPU 使用率是由于 WebView2 的使用方式,而不是 WebView2 本身。 如果应用程序正在呈现非优化的 Web 内容,则 WebView2 控件可能会消耗更多资源。 任务管理器通常显示按父级分组的进程,但如果按 名称以外的列排序,该视图有时不正确。

WebView2 进程在任务管理器的“ 进程 ”选项卡中显示为 WebView2,按父应用分组。 例如,“ Win32 应用中的 WebView2 入门”中的 WebView2 应用 在任务管理器的“ 进程 ”选项卡中列出,如下所示。

在 Windows 10 和早期版本的 Windows 11 中,“进程”选项卡仅列出使用 WebView2 的应用的名称:

在最新的 Windows 11 版本中,“进程”选项卡列出了每个 WebView2 进程:

在“ 详细信息 ”选项卡中,WebView2 进程列为 msedgewebview2.exe,并分组在一起,而不是按父应用分组:

还可以使用 Microsoft 的进程资源管理器 工具。 如果发现某个应用一直导致大量资源使用,请联系该应用的支持人员报告资源使用情况。

卸载 Microsoft Edge 是否会使 WebView2 停止工作?

不需要。 可以卸载 Microsoft Edge,而不会对 WebView2 造成问题。 安装 Microsoft Edge 和 WebView2 后,Microsoft Edge 安装程序会将应用程序链接在一起,以避免使用额外的磁盘空间。

为什么在卸载 WebView2 后重新安装?

WebView2 预安装在 Windows 11 上,安装在大多数Windows 10设备上。 请参阅将 Microsoft Edge WebView2 运行时交付给Windows 10使用者。

许多基于 WebView2 构建的应用会在安装或启动应用时执行检查以重新安装 WebView2。 企业还可以将 WebView2 推送到他们管理的设备。

另请参阅 Microsoft Edge WebView2 简介 联系 WebView2 团队


【本文地址】


今日新闻


推荐新闻


CopyRight 2018-2019 办公设备维修网 版权所有 豫ICP备15022753号-3